In the swirling currents of contemporary society, characterized by its relentless pace and perpetual flux, the individual finds themselves adrift in what sociologist Zygmunt Bauman termed "liquid modernity." This concept, explored extensively in his influential body of work, describes a world where traditional structures and solid institutions have melted into a fluid, uncertain state.
